About the Position:
A Sr. Launch Program Manager orchestrates the entire organization in preparation of a release and launch of a new product or organizational program. The leadership of the Launch Manager will ensure the cross-functional team of representatives across the entire Mimecast organization stay focused on the strategic goals and requirements. Overall, they are responsible for the preparations, impacts, and risks to ensure Mimecast is ready to deliver the Solution, while ensuring our overall ability to Sell, Service and Support the customer through the entire experience. This is achieved by understanding what the functional area requirements are for the program, understanding organizational dependencies between functional groups, as well as anticipating and accessing risks of the program. For every one of these items, the Launch Manager must understand the impacts to the functional areas, as well as on the entire organization.
